Abstract: | The Lithuanian National Time and Frequency Standard Laboratory is responsible for maintenance and dissemination of the national time scale UTC (LT), time and frequency units. Since June 2001, we have been contributing to TAI. The Laboratory is equipped with two HP5071A cesium atomic clocks (one with a high-performance Cs tube) and two TTS-2 multi-channel GPS receivers based on Motorola VP Oncore GPS processors. One of the GPS receivers is equipped with thermo-stabilized GPS antenna. For the dissemination of the Lithuanian Time Scale UTC (LT), the NTP server Datum 2001 is used. In this paper, the main metrological characteristics and technical possibilities of the National Time and Frequency Standards are presented. |
